InterDigital traded at $371.08 this Friday February 6th, increasing $26.03 or 7.54 percent since the previous trading session. Looking back, over the last four weeks, InterDigital gained 20.00 percent. Over the last 12 months, its price rose by 81.55 percent. Looking ahead, we forecast InterDigital to be priced at 316.39 by the end of this quarter and at 288.04 in one year, according to Trading Economics global macro models projections and analysts expectations.

InterDigital, Inc. is a research and development company that licenses its innovations to the global wireless and consumer electronics industries. The Company designs and develops technologies that enable connected, experiences in a range of communications and entertainment products and services. Through its subsidiaries, it owns a portfolio of patents and patent applications related to wireless communications, video coding, display technology, and other areas relevant to the wireless and consumer electronics industries. It operates InterDigital Research & Innovation (InterDigital R&I), a research and development operation. The Company operates approximately seven research and development facilities in five countries: Berlin, Germany; Conshohocken, Pennsylvania, United States of America; London, United Kingdom; Montreal, Canada; New York, New York, United States of America; Palo Alto, California, United States of America, and Rennes, France.
